Pros & Cons
👍 Pros
- 16GB of RAM provides comfortable headroom for multitasking and running multiple browser tabs
- 512GB SSD delivers fast boot times and responsive application loading
- Includes a full numeric keypad for efficient data entry
- Lightweight at 3.75 pounds for a 15.6-inch laptop
- Good port selection including USB-C, USB-A, HDMI, and SD card reader
👎 Cons
- HD 1366x768 resolution is noticeably less sharp than Full HD, especially on a 15.6-inch screen
- Integrated Radeon graphics are not suitable for gaming or video editing workloads
- Ryzen 3 5300U is an entry-level processor that may lag under sustained heavy tasks
- Wi-Fi 5 is a generation behind current Wi-Fi 6 standards
- No backlit keyboard, which limits usability in low-light environments
